Etheridgia
Taxonomy
Etheridgia was named by Tate (1865) [Sepkoski's age data: K Sant K Sn Sepkoski's reference number: 622]. It is not extant. Its type is Etheridgia mirabilis.
It was assigned to Hexactinosa by Sepkoski (2002); to Lychniscosa by Mermighis and Marcopoulou-Diacantoni (2004); and to Cameroptychinae by Finks et al. (2004).
